Transaction ff4080997d114782082e11cbd5df1f5d915feb42f2ff945a1838e29607d116ca
2 Input
2 Outputs
- ff4080997d114782082e11cbd5df1f5d915feb42f2ff945a1838e29607d116ca:0
- ff4080997d114782082e11cbd5df1f5d915feb42f2ff945a1838e29607d116ca:1
value 951766
address 1DCpU5hNJnSqW2a84BX2Pf6bVUwuW8swdp
value 5950000
address 1PiBjUZ62s3oEKgbZbumiB8hSXmbgP9L2S